Star cricketer Virat Kohli, accompanied by his wife and actress Anushka Sharma, sought spiritual solace in Vrindavan by visiting Premanand Govind Sharan Ji Maharaj.

This visit came a day after Kohli's retirement announcement from Test cricket. A video shared on the platform 'X' captured the couple's interaction with the revered leader.

During their time at the Shri Radha Keli Kunj Ashram, Kohli and Anushka engaged in discussions about inner peace, guided by Premanand Ji's teachings. Kohli particularly focused on spiritual reflection following his retirement.
